Key Words |
Polydatin; Food allergy; Mast cells; Store-operated calcium channels; Ca2+ |
Core Tip |
In the present study, we have demonstrated for the first time that polydatin has the capacity for preventing pathogenesis of food allergy, which is dependent on regulation of Ca2+ mobilization via store-operated calcium channels in mast cells.
